Implementation Of Blockchain in Education

Issues in the current education system and different educational organizations can be resolved using blockchain technology in the core area. Furthermore, it can be determined using blockchain technology in the education system.

Blockchain can transform the traditional record storage of students and the staff over the distributed network. As the data is stored on the distributed system, it is secure and more transparent. In addition, the overall data accuracy and immutability is preserved in the distributed blockchain environment.

Generally, Blockchain consists of the various steps while deploying the data onto the blockchain network. Therefore, start trading to get into blockchain. Usually, the verifying authorities and the central institutions take more time to carry out the operations, which is time-consuming. Using blockchain technology, we can eliminate the risk of significant server downtime. As we are not relying on the central authority, the process takes a fewer amount of time. In addition, the data stored on the Blockchain is tamper-proof and cannot be modified once deployed on the blockchain network.

Blockchain In Education

In education systems, the certificates state that the achievements of the learners or educators and different activities are mostly issued on paper or other physical formats. However, paper certificates are prone to tampering and forging. On the other hand, the digital certificates stored on the blockchain networks are difficult to forge, and they are tamper-proof.

Blockchain technology supports protection against counterfeit certificates and simplified verification of Certificates with a lesser amount of resources. Blockchain consists of three steps while considering the digital certification and storing the data onto the Blockchain.

Educators only receive copies or notarized work of learner’s paper certificates. To verify these certificates, the educators need to rely on the central authority. It is a time-consuming process so that blockchain technology can be effectively used in the education system.

Currently, the Sony and University of Nicosia have successfully implemented the Blockchain in education to store digital certificates and issue degrees.

Digital Certification

Initially, the learner inputs his personal information with the unique id, and then the data is kept on to the learner’s Blockchain. Later the data sent for verification to the respective verifying institution. Finally, after successful confirmation of the data, the success token is sent to the learner, and then the data is safely stored onto the institute’s private blockchain network.

Essential Characteristics of Digital Certificates 

The certificates are stored digitally onto the blockchain network with the generated hash. Here the issuer and the verifying authority has their separate Blockchain for storing the digital certificates. Over the regular certificates, they are stored digitally on thousands of computers, which will make them more secure and robust than the standard certificates. In addition, it requires fewer resources to maintain, issue and access than the existing digital certification.

Digital Signature

The digital signature consists of the time stamp, which is indeed generated by the specific user and cannot be modified or tampered with. Here the user uses the private key to sign the document digitally and to use his public key. The recipient can verify the identity and confirm the record. The digital signature is more secured than the electronic signature and can be used to keep data more securely.

Benefits over Traditional Approach

Without the central authority, we can apply the Blockchain in the education system, which can be used in the formal assessment and storing the digital certificate and the degrees. Informal learning data such as the research experience, skills and the online learning experiences and individual interests can be easily stored onto the Blockchain is a safer format. Private information of learners and educators can be held onto the blockchain networks in immutable form.

Distributed Database in Educational

The Environment Blockchain ledger is distributed so the remaining candidates can monitor any changes made to reduce problems like degree fraud. As the overall data is stored on the distributed blockchain network, all the learners can keep track of the details, so the widespread tampering of the actual data can be avoided, as the blocks on the Blockchain cannot be altered once they are deployed. Using the proof of work algorithm, the data stored on the distributed blockchain network can be verified, and then it’ll be held on the web with valid credentials.

System Working Overview

The learner consists of their ID, which will help them to identify them on the blockchain network. They are provided with different rights while storing the data on to Blockchain. For example, learners can inert the theory attendance, insert assignment marks, insert lab and test attendances. After confirming the learner’s identity through the verifying institution, he can successfully store the data onto the Blockchain using the smart contracts.

Future Educational Applications

  • “Learning is earning” can be applied by considering the digital currencies in the learner’s wallet, and it can motivate learners to join different educational activities.
  • Formative assessment is challenging as we need to record all the details of the learner’s activities. It can be made more simplified and can be used more systematically in the educational system.
  • We can maintain the digital identity of the difference between these parties safe, and it can be securely stored on the blockchain network.
  • The smart contract will reduce the overall need for the third party’s involvement and increase the overall performance.
  • The more the educational issues can be solved using intelligent contract-based blockchain systems.
  • Every detail of teaching and learning can be made more simplified using blockchain techniques.


Blockchain works on distributed technology. Smart contracts can be designed and deployed to the Ethereum blockchain that can be created using the solidity programming language. Blockchain can be applied to private, public and consortium sectors depending upon the usage and the scope of the Blockchain. The education system can benefit from this scalability of the Blockchain and can be effectively helpful in educational institutions.